问题标签 [active-directory-group]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
active-directory - 服务器不愿意处理请求 - Active Directory - 通过 C# 添加用户
我使用此页面中的示例将用户添加到 Active Directory 组,但在执行时出现异常消息“服务器不愿意处理请求”
dirEntry.Properties["member"].Add(userDn);
vb.net - 将 AD 用户添加到 AD 组
我有一个 VB 应用程序 (.NET 4.0),用户在其中选择他们拥有的 AD 组,然后可以将预定义列表中的用户添加到该组。从 AD 中提取的组和从 Oracle 中提取的用户都是现有的 AD 用户。
您将看到三个带注释的代码块,我已经尝试了所有三个并得到“COMException is unhandled by user code: Unspecified error”。
active-directory - 我可以在 Active Directory 中使用现有名称创建新的全局安全组吗?
如何创建一个名为 的全局安全组finance
,因为我在 Active Directory 中已经有一个具有该名称的用户。可能吗?
c# - 无论用户是在组还是子组中,如何在广告中进行递归搜索?
嗨,我在 ASP.NET 应用程序中使用 Active Directory 和 C#,如果用户在组或此子组中,我希望得到一个布尔值。我写了一个方法来让我知道用户是否在组中但不在这个子组中:(
如何在我的方法中进行递归搜索:
这是我的代码:
c# - Active Directory 历史成员资格
是否可以判断用户在过去的给定日期是否是某个组的成员?
excel - 组所有所有者的 LDAP 查询
问题
我需要编写一个 LDAP 查询,给定一个distinguishedName
for agroup
将返回一个列表,其中列出了所有users
的所有者/管理者group
动机
我正在编写一个 VBA 脚本,该脚本将允许 excel 用户在单元格中输入 aDisplayName
并group
按下按钮以接收(1)成员列表和(2)单独的组所有者列表。
进步
第一部分工作正常。我在目录中搜索在其字段中拥有该组的所有用户。memberof
对于所有者,我成功拉取了组的managedBy
字段,但它只包含单个用户的信息。当在 Outlook 的通讯簿中查看该组时,该用户与“所有者”字段中显示的用户相同。还有更多拥有该列表所有权权限的用户。
例子
这是我现在使用的两个(稍作修改)查询:
查询1:组成员(作品)
查询 2:Group Owners(返回单个用户)
问题
如何修改查询 2 以返回对组具有管理权限的所有用户?
相关问题
c# - 使用 C# 将用户添加到 Active Directory 组时遇到问题
好的,我现在的问题是我们正在尝试编写将用户添加到我们 Active Directory 中不同组的代码。这是我们编写的解决方案。
部分主要方法:
从另一个类调用此方法:
它抛出异常
System.Runtime.InteropServices.COMException (0x80020006):未知名称。(来自 HRESULT 的异常:0x80020006 (DISP_E_UNKNOWNNAME)) 在 C:\Users\XXX\Documents\ 中的 adjustUsers.Program.AddToGroup(String userDn, String groupDn)
的 System.DirectoryServices.DirectoryEntry.InvokeSet(String propertyName, Object[] args)
Visual Studio 2010\Projects\UserPruning\adjustUsers\Program.cs:
C:\Users\XXX\Documents\Visual Studio 2010\Projects\UserPruning\UserPruning\MainProgram 中 UserPruning.MainProgram.Main(String[] args) 的第 45 行。 CS:第 46 行
据我们所知,这表明我们的语法存在问题。
第 46 行是
第 45 行是
前一天我们一直在尝试重写这段代码,但仍然很困惑。
帮助?
谢谢
powershell - 如何在powershell中使用获得的凭据来查找经过身份验证的用户组?
我写了一个脚本,它在执行时要求提供凭据;它是这样的;
-> 我后来意识到我的错误,最后一行收集了登录到Windows机器的用户组。我需要通过脚本进行身份验证的人的组;如何更改这一点并获取通过脚本而不是使用 Windows 身份验证的人的组?
请让我知道任何问题或澄清。
active-directory - 使用 rfc2254 中指定的 objectGUID 编码的活动目录过滤器不起作用
我正在使用 java ldap 访问活动目录,更具体地说是 spring ldap。当过滤器按照 rfc2254 中的指定进行编码时,按 objectGUID 进行的组搜索不会产生任何结果。
这是其十六进制表示形式的指南:
spring ldap 像这样对过滤器进行编码:
如rfc2254和 microsoft technet中所述:
该字符必须编码为反斜杠 '' 字符 (ASCII 0x5c),后跟表示编码字符的 ASCII 值的两个十六进制数字。两个十六进制数字的大小写无关紧要。块引用
所以反斜杠应该是 '\5c'
但我没有得到来自 AD 的上述过滤器的结果。另外,如果我将该过滤器放在 AD 管理控制台自定义过滤器中,它也不起作用。当我从过滤器中删除 5c 时,它可以在 java 和 AD 控制台中使用。
我在这里错过了什么吗?
当然,我可以在没有 5c 的情况下对过滤器进行编码,但我不确定它是否正确,我更喜欢让 spring 对过滤器进行编码,因为它知道很多我应该手动完成的事情。
active-directory - ADSI LDAP query for Remote Desktop Users
I am trying to figure the ADSI query to get the list of users added to the group Remote Desktop Users
in an AD domain.
I guess I need to set the appropriate filter to get the result.
I tried something like
but it doesn't work.
Thanks Sunil